先去下載xdebug.dll文件。將下面本身的phpinfo的文字信息複製到https://xdebug.org/wizard.php中,下載它提供的xdebug.dll的版本php
下載完成後將php_xdebug-2.6.0-7.2-vc15-x86_64.dll(我下載的版本)複製到php安裝目錄的ext文件夾中(D:\phpTools\php7\ext);php7
配置php.ini文件,在php.ini文件的最後加上下面的信息:app
;; phpstorm的debug調試設置 [XDebug] zend_extension = "D:\phpTools\php7\ext\php_xdebug-2.6.0-7.2-vc15-x86_64.dll" ;xdebug.dll的路徑 xdebug.profiler_append = 0 xdebug.profiler_enable = 1 xdebug.profiler_enable_trigger = 0 xdebug.profiler_output_dir = "\phpTools\php7\tmp" xdebug.profiler_output_name = "cachegrind.out.%t-%s" xdebug.remote_enable = 1 xdebug.remote_handler = "dbgp" xdebug.remote_mode = "req" xdebug.remote_port = 9000
保存後重啓Apache,訪問phpinfo頁面,獲得下面的信息表示已經安裝好xdebug。phpstorm
到phpstorm配置測試:debug端口號要和php.ini中配置的同樣測試
配置server中的訪問路徑(域名,或本身配置的站點名)spa
配置好以後點擊ok後就能夠去作debug測試了debug
測試好了以後建議把設置刪除掉,點擊紅框進去調試
選中要刪除的選項,點擊左上角的「—」號就能夠了code